Additional protection for geographical indications extends to wines and spirits under the Geographical Indications Act notification. The Central Government, exercising its statutory power to extend additional protection under the Geographical Indication regime, notifies that the goods listed in the Schedule are granted additional protection; the Schedule specifies that wines and spirits are extended such protection.
